DO read the sticky.
Ammo CANNOT be mailed by US Mail. Brass, yes, ammo, no.
Up to 66 lbs of ammo can be shipped by UPS without HAZMAT fees.
List contents as "Cartridges, small arms".
The NEW label that replaced the ORM-D label looks like this- no text.

Ammo is no longer marked "ORDM" and hasn't for several years. You now use the label that looks like a half black and half white box. Most counters have them. Most contract shippers can't accept ammo have to take it to the actual UPS counter. Other than that no big deal. 0 -

FedEx will ship ammo, but only by scheduled pick up. Do not take ammo to a FedEx terminal or a FedEx Office store.
DOT regulations apply.
